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- The effect of the proposed development on the character and appearance of the site and surrounding area
What decided it
The forward projection of the extension would materially disrupt the uniform building line and regular pattern along Cardinal Road, thereby harming the character and appearance of the surrounding area in conflict with the development plan.
Framework references: 135
Plan policies cited: Policy P10 of the Leeds Core Strategy, Policy BD6 of the Leeds Unitary Development Plan (Review) (2006), Policy GP5 of the Leeds Unitary Development Plan (Review) (2006), Neighbourhoods for Living Guide (2003)
